My Multiflight experience...so far:
I am starting training with these guys soon. I just dropped in on them without an appointment and asked one of their instructors to talk to me about the ab initio ATPL, and the modular route as well.
We talked for over an hour about the options, and how the modular route might be approached. He answered a huge number of questions and was very knowledgable: also didn't have the 'Multiflight is everything' attitude, was perfectly willing to suggest other options that could suit me.
After that we walked over to the hangar and had a look around at the aircraft.
They are also willing to accept payment for services received, rather than up-front, as they should really!
Generally I found them to be a helpful and knowledgable bunch with genuine enthusiasm.
If you are unsure if you want to train there, pick a day with bad weather (one of Leeds Bradford's unfortunate problems) and drop in for a chat. Thats what I did, and I was very pleased I did.
